Rustic Crates Shelving

DIY Rustic Farmhouse Bedroom Decor 3
Source: kreadiy.com

For you who love recycling unused stuff for your DIY project, this idea is a great inspiration to try. A shelf which is made of 4 wood crates decorates the corner of the room. It doesn’t only give a rustic touch to the overall look of the room but also provides a convenient storage station for your daily items.

You just have to stack the crates that you can buy cheaply or even get some for free to create this creative shelf!

Simple Rustic Light

DIY Rustic Farmhouse Bedroom Decor 5
Source: emerciv.com

This idea shows an easy way to turn your plain boring table lamp into gorgeous bedroom decor. Grab some rustic ropes and wrap the base of your table light with them. For sure, this wrapped table light will give a simple rustic touch to the decor of your bedroom.

To complement the rustic table light, an indoor plant in the planter with a distressed finish is placed close to it.

Memo Clip Holder

DIY Rustic Farmhouse Bedroom Decor 6
Source: hallomontag.blogspot.com

Having a physical reminder in your bedroom decor is never a bad idea and if you’d like to have one, this project is definitely a must-try. You will need to prepare a wood plank with a distressed finish to make the decor look rustic then add some nails.

The nails will work to hold some memo clips and you can use them to attach some notes, photographs, or decorative prints. It’s an effortless idea to add a simple farmhouse touch to your bedroom decor.

Beautiful Rustic Decor

You will get to know how to create two superbly creative DIY rustic farmhouse bedroom decor projects in this video. The projects include how to create a gorgeous window wreath and floral orb to style up your bedroom with farmhouse style.

The steps to get the project include:

Floral orb

  1. Prepare some painted embroidery hoops and build the orb construction, use a glue gun to stick each one of them.
  2. Place faux flowers and leaves inside the orb construction.
  3. Use twine to hang the orb inside your bedroom.

Window wreath

  1. Prepare a faux greenery wreath that you can find in the nearby decor store.
  2. To create the wreath, you should grab an old window panel and chicken wire mesh.
  3. Place the wreath on the window panel, and you can hang the wreath above your headboard.

How to Create a Farmhouse Look In Your Bedroom

  • Neutral shades, always

The first rule to achieving a farmhouse look inside your bedroom is to avoid dark or bold shades to paint the walls. Always choose soft and bright colors like white, grey, and beige as the main shades of the palette. It’s because neutral shades help everything to blend together very well, considering that farmhouse decor can contain tons of elements.

Also, it’s a wiser idea to paint all sides of the wall in a similar color instead of trying to mix more than one.

  • Prioritize textures

It may be tempting to bring tons of colorful elements to your bedroom but if you’re planning to bring farmhouse nuance around, think twice. Instead of focusing on colors, bring as many textures as possible to enhance the attractiveness of your farmhouse bedroom which complement the main colors of the room harmoniously.

For instance, installing a breadboard on one side of the walls can help give stunning texture all around.

  • Recycling, recycling, and recycling

A vintage vibe can’t be separated from a farmhouse decorating style. That being said, you can always use unused items that have been sitting around your house all this time. For instance, an old galvanized bucket can become a rustic planter for your indoor plants and a wood crate can work as an additional storage station in the room.

Besides creating a beautifully distinctive decor, you can also save your budget at the same time.
